Ingredients
- 1 lb chicken breast or thighs,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 2 cups fresh cheese tortellini
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 4 tbsp butter
- 1 tsp crushed red pepper flakes
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- Fresh basil or parsley for garnish
Instructions
- In a large pot, melt butter over medium-high heat. Season chicken with salt and pepper; cook until browned (6–8 minutes). Remove from pot and set aside.
- In the same pot, add more butter and sauté minced garlic until fragrant (about 30 seconds). Stir in red pepper flakes.
- Pour in chicken broth, scraping any browned bits from the bottom. Stir in heavy cream and bring to a simmer.
- Add tortellini; cook for 4–6 minutes until tender.
- Return chicken to the pot, stir in Parmesan until melted, then cook for an additional 2–3 minutes before serving.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
